Summary:
At Reality Labs Research, we are at the forefront of pioneering research into new technologies aimed at revolutionizing user interface technologies for the next generation of virtual, augmented, and mixed reality experiences. Our focus is on developing soft and conformable wearables that provide seamless user experiences, addressing both integration and manufacturing challenges to shape the future of XR interactions. As a Research Scientist Intern, you will collaborate with a team of expert research scientists, hardware engineers, and software developers. Your role will involve building groundbreaking prototypes and advancing the technology that will make XR universal. Our internships are twelve (12) to twenty-four (24) weeks long and we have various start dates throughout the year.
Required Skills:
Research Scientist Intern, Soft Wearable Tactile Sensors (PhD) Responsibilities:
1. Design, prototype, and characterize novel wearable tactile sensors able to detect and predict slip and/or cover large area with high density resolution.
2. Research, develop, and characterize the next generation of soft wearable sensing technologies.
3. Collaborate with the larger Reality Labs team and provide creative solutions to challenges in soft wearables and sensing technologies.
4. Emphasis on fundamental scientific and engineering questions related to the complex deformation of soft wearable technologies.
5. Use experimental and characterization data to improve designs of tactile sensors.
6. Communicate or publish research activities and findings to collaborators across a variety of disciplines.
